Transaction 84332713473866868b8aa5849f27820e4305bb9980be825e36e20a503ef9483b
1 Input
1 Output
-
84332713473866868b8aa5849f27820e4305bb9980be825e36e20a503ef9483b:0
- value
- 17844700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 60e62c476992eeecb53103848697b86dc9f83fa8 OP_EQUAL
- address
- 3AXNXf5r8giuXJDqmAtvQhUMQ7aRC5Meif